Output 7186cb53392f5d860424b9b6212da5e14224f12120917eacf8ed62ad757789f7:3

value
23824591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f76291b70589176ec5be5b586066350b60289f6 OP_EQUAL
address
MKX7bjVAgE4mH9vtZpUA8Kh2jftYLQN1p1
transaction
7186cb53392f5d860424b9b6212da5e14224f12120917eacf8ed62ad757789f7
spent
true